diff --git a/custom.el b/custom.el index 82b7aeb..45b4c13 100644 --- a/custom.el +++ b/custom.el @@ -16,7 +16,7 @@ '(lsp-java-format-settings-profile nil) '(lsp-pylsp-plugins-jedi-use-pyenv-environment t) '(org-agenda-files - '("~/Documents/research/DBS/TechnicalEvaluation/technicaldraft.org" "/Users/universelaptop/Documents/research/CommitteeMeetings/First/Report/David_Crompton_Masters_Supervisory_Committee_Meeting_Report.org" "/Users/universelaptop/Documents/research/thesis/Ideas/ModelDetails.org" "/Users/universelaptop/Documents/uoft/JPB1071/WrittenAssignment/Crompton_David_1004162434_JPB1071_Written_Assignment.org")) + '("/Users/universelaptop/Documents/Blender/eCal/SpecSheet/spec.org" "/Users/universelaptop/Documents/Development/pyBQN/doc/VM/notes.org" "/Users/universelaptop/Documents/Development/syzygial/syzygui/README.org" "/Users/universelaptop/Documents/Development/syzygial/web/syzygial-cc/content/blog/articles.org" "/Users/universelaptop/Documents/Development/syzygial/web/syzygial-cc/content/main/about.org" "/Users/universelaptop/Documents/Development/syzygial/web/syzygial-cc/content/main/index.org" "/Users/universelaptop/Documents/Resume_and_CV/cv.org" "/Users/universelaptop/Documents/Resume_and_CV/resume.org" "/Users/universelaptop/Documents/org/dates.org" "/Users/universelaptop/Documents/research/AntidromROOTs/TechnicalPaper/Refdoc/majorrefs.org" "/Users/universelaptop/Documents/research/AntidromROOTs/CodeOverview.org" "/Users/universelaptop/Documents/research/CommitteeMeetings/First/Report/David_Crompton_Masters_Supervisory_Committee_Meeting_Report.org" "/Users/universelaptop/Documents/research/DBS/ERNA/AbstractModel/Methods/MethodsModel.org" "/Users/universelaptop/Documents/research/DBS/ERNA/AbstractModel/Results/Limitations.org" "/Users/universelaptop/Documents/research/DBS/ERNA/AbstractModel/Results/Results.org" "/Users/universelaptop/Documents/research/DBS/ERNA/NEURON/old/Tutorial/Tutorial.org" "/Users/universelaptop/Documents/research/DBS/ERNA/NEURON/old/README.org" "/Users/universelaptop/Documents/research/DBS/ERNA/Notes/ModelProposals/MeanOrNeural/diagram/diagram.org" "/Users/universelaptop/Documents/research/DBS/ERNA/PBLIF/README.org" "/Users/universelaptop/Documents/research/DBS/ERNA/TMP/README.org" "/Users/universelaptop/Documents/research/DBS/ERNA/Materials.org" "/Users/universelaptop/Documents/research/DBS/TechnicalEvaluation/technicaldraft.org" "/Users/universelaptop/Documents/research/MPS/MPSModel/modelResearch.org" "/Users/universelaptop/Documents/research/MPS/MPS_Antidromic_STDP/README.org" "/Users/universelaptop/Documents/research/MPS/ModelProposal/model_proposal.org" "/Users/universelaptop/Documents/research/MiladMeetings/Notes.org" "/Users/universelaptop/Documents/research/Morris_Lecar_SK/README.org" "/Users/universelaptop/Documents/research/OLM_Model/OLM_Single_Compartment/Equations/equations.org" "/Users/universelaptop/Documents/research/StateEstimation/OLM/OLM_Equations/equations.org" "/Users/universelaptop/Documents/research/StateEstimation/OLM/OpenAccess/README.org" "/Users/universelaptop/Documents/research/StateEstimation/README.org" "/Users/universelaptop/Documents/research/conferences/krembil_research_day/2023/abstract.org" "/Users/universelaptop/Documents/research/fpga/NEURON/ideas/proposal/proposal.org" "/Users/universelaptop/Documents/research/grants/CIHR/CGS-D/2022/ResearchProposal.org" "/Users/universelaptop/Documents/research/grants/CIHR/CGS-D/2023/LukaSupportBlurbs.org" "/Users/universelaptop/Documents/research/grants/CIHR/CGS-D/2023/ResearchProposal.org" "/Users/universelaptop/Documents/research/grants/GooglePhdFellowship/2023/EssayResponses/Responses.org" "/Users/universelaptop/Documents/research/grants/GooglePhdFellowship/2023/ResearchProposal/Crompton_David_1004162434_Transfer_Thesis_Proposal.org" "/Users/universelaptop/Documents/research/grants/GooglePhdFellowship/2023/README.org" "/Users/universelaptop/Documents/research/grants/Milad/2023/Feb/ModelDescription.org" "/Users/universelaptop/Documents/research/grants/OGS/2022/PlanOfStudy.org" "/Users/universelaptop/Documents/research/grants/OGS/2022/Research.org" "/Users/universelaptop/Documents/research/grants/OIST/2023/application.org" "/Users/universelaptop/Documents/research/review/GEMsort/review.org" "/Users/universelaptop/Documents/research/skml/FPGA/SKML_3D.org" "/Users/universelaptop/Documents/research/skml/draft/SKML_firstdraft.org" "/Users/universelaptop/Documents/research/skml/paper/SKML_first_draft.org" "/Users/universelaptop/Documents/research/thesis/Ideas/ModelDetails.org" "/Users/universelaptop/Documents/research/thesis/firstMeeting/proposal.org" "/Users/universelaptop/Documents/research/thesis/transfer/Crompton_David_1004162434_Transfer_Thesis_Proposal.org" "/Users/universelaptop/Documents/uoft/BME1477/AlumniInterview/AlumniInterview.org" "/Users/universelaptop/Documents/uoft/BME1477/PeerReview/JoseValenzuela/Peer_Review.org" "/Users/universelaptop/Documents/uoft/BME1477/PeerReview/KatieDoran/Peer_Review.org" "/Users/universelaptop/Documents/uoft/BME1477/Proposal_Edit/Proposal_Edit.org" "/Users/universelaptop/Documents/uoft/BME1477/PCA4.org" "/Users/universelaptop/Documents/uoft/BME1477/PCA5.org" "/Users/universelaptop/Documents/uoft/BME1477/PCA6.org" "/Users/universelaptop/Documents/uoft/BME1477/Proposal_Draft.org" "/Users/universelaptop/Documents/uoft/BME1477/Proposal_Outline.org" "/Users/universelaptop/Documents/uoft/BME1478/week1/assignment/Week1_Crompton_David_1004162434.org" "/Users/universelaptop/Documents/uoft/BME1478/week2/assignment/Crompton_David_1004162434.org" "/Users/universelaptop/Documents/uoft/BME1478/week3/assignment/Crompton_David_1004162434_Week3.org" "/Users/universelaptop/Documents/uoft/BME1478/week4/assignment/Instructions.org" "/Users/universelaptop/Documents/uoft/BME1500/LiteratureReview/LitReview.org" "/Users/universelaptop/Documents/uoft/BME1500/PeerReview/Crompton_David_1004162434_PeerReview.org" "/Users/universelaptop/Documents/uoft/BME1500/Presentations_Day1.org" "/Users/universelaptop/Documents/uoft/BME1500/Presentations_Day2.org" "/Users/universelaptop/Documents/uoft/BME1500/lecture10.org" "/Users/universelaptop/Documents/uoft/BME1500/lecture12.org" "/Users/universelaptop/Documents/uoft/BME1500/lecture2.org" "/Users/universelaptop/Documents/uoft/BME1500/lecture3.org" "/Users/universelaptop/Documents/uoft/BME1500/lecture4.org" "/Users/universelaptop/Documents/uoft/BME1500/lecture5.org" "/Users/universelaptop/Documents/uoft/BME1500/lecture6.org" "/Users/universelaptop/Documents/uoft/BME1500/lecture7.org" "/Users/universelaptop/Documents/uoft/BME1500/lecture8.org" "/Users/universelaptop/Documents/uoft/BME1500/lecture9.org" "/Users/universelaptop/Documents/uoft/BME1802/assignment/riskanalysis/hazop.org" "/Users/universelaptop/Documents/uoft/BME1802/assignment/riskanalysis_review/peerreview.org" "/Users/universelaptop/Documents/uoft/JPB1071/NEURON/lecture/Lecture.org" "/Users/universelaptop/Documents/uoft/JPB1071/OralPres/Crompton_David_1004162434_Presentation.org" "/Users/universelaptop/Documents/uoft/JPB1071/OralRev/Reviews.org" "/Users/universelaptop/Documents/uoft/JPB1071/WrittenAssignment/Crompton_David_1004162434_JPB1071_Written_Assignment.org" "/Users/universelaptop/Documents/uoft/JPH441/Essay3/Crompton_David_1004162434_Essay3.org" "/Users/universelaptop/Documents/uoft/JPH441/FinalEssay/Crompton_David_1004162434_Final_Essay.org" "/Users/universelaptop/Documents/uoft/JPH441/VideoEssay/VideoEssay_Discussion_Crompton_David_1004162434.org" "/Users/universelaptop/Documents/uoft/PHY354/FINAL/Q2E.org" "/Users/universelaptop/Documents/uoft/PHY354/PS5/Q1.org" "/Users/universelaptop/Documents/uoft/PHY354/PS5/Q4.org" "/Users/universelaptop/Documents/uoft/PSL1441/Essay/crompton_david_1004162434.org" "/Users/universelaptop/Documents/uoft/PSL1441/auditory/lec1/lec1.org" "/Users/universelaptop/Documents/uoft/PSL1441/auditory/lec2/lec2.org" "/Users/universelaptop/Documents/uoft/PSL1441/auditory/lec3/lec3.org" "/Users/universelaptop/Documents/uoft/PSL1441/auditory/lec5/lec5.org" "/Users/universelaptop/Documents/uoft/PSL1441/lec3/lec3.org" "/Users/universelaptop/Documents/uoft/PSL1441/lec4/lec4.org" "/Users/universelaptop/Documents/uoft/PSL1441/lec5/lec5.org" "/Users/universelaptop/Documents/uoft/PSY492/Research_Proposal/Crompton_David_1004162434_PSY492_Research_Proposal.org" "/Users/universelaptop/Documents/uoft/TA/CoverLetter/Template.org" "/Users/universelaptop/Documents/uoft/phy324/Lab-2-ThermalMotion/Crompton_David_1004162434_Thermal_Motion.org" "/Users/universelaptop/Documents/uoft/phy324/Lab1_DCPOWER/Crompton_David_1004162434_DCPOWER.org" "/Users/universelaptop/Documents/uoft/phy324/Lab_3_Interferometer/Crompton_David_1004162434_PHY324_Lab_Interferometer.org" "/Users/universelaptop/Documents/uoft/phy324/Lab_4_ChargeMass/Crompton_David_1004162434_PHY324_ChargeMass.org" "/Users/universelaptop/Documents/uoft/phy324/Pendulum/Crompton_David_1004162434_PHY324_Pendulum.org" "/Users/universelaptop/Documents/uoft/phy324/lab4/DCPOWER_LAB.org" "/Users/universelaptop/Documents/uoft/MASc_Statement_Of_Intent.org")) '(org-export-backends '(ascii beamer html icalendar latex odt)) '(org-latex-classes '(("labtemplate" "\\documentclass{labtemplate}" diff --git a/main.org b/main.org index 41bcc98..869c5ad 100644 --- a/main.org +++ b/main.org @@ -397,6 +397,53 @@ And in case we want to make some (GNU)?plots? (leaf gnuplot :ensure t) #+end_src +*** Org Mode Agenda/Calendar Things + +**** Agenda Location +Make it so that all files in the src_elisp{org-agenda-files} variable +(e.g. "=~/Documents=") will be included in the tablutation and +collation of all the dates and todos etc. + +#+begin_src elisp :tangle yes + (leaf org-agenda-file + :after org + :config + (setq org-agenda-files '("~/Documents/org"))) +#+end_src + +**** Capture Things + +Unless specified otherwise, any captured note, date, meeting, idea, +should be put into the src_elisp{org-directory}. + +Similarly, we have a default file for notes that we capture, in there +=note.org=, which is where all captured things go when they aren't +told to go elsewhere. + +#+begin_src elisp :tangle yes + (leaf org-capture-cfg + :after org + :config + (setq org-directory "~/Documents/org") + (setq org-default-notes-file (concat org-directory "/notes.org"))) +#+end_src + +We also want to configure what type of things we want to capture, +e.g. meetings, deadlines and whatever else: + +#+begin_src elisp :tangle yes + (leaf org-capture-what + :after org + :config + (setq org-capture-templates + '(("t" "Todo" entry (file+headline "todo.org" "Tasks") + "* TODO %?\n %i\n %a") + ("j" "Journal" entry (file+datetree "journal.org") + "* %?\nEntered on %U\n %i\n %a") + ("m" "Meeting" entry (file+headline "dates.org" "Meetings") + "* %^{prompt}\n:PROPERTIES:\n:CATEGORY: Meeting\n:END:\nWhen: %^t\nAdded: %U\nTags: %^g\n%?")))) +#+end_src + ** Flutter #+begin_src elisp :tangle yes (leaf dart-mode :ensure t)